Abstract: A bridge driver circuit (104) applies a bias voltage across first (142) and second (144) input nodes of a resistive bridge circuit (102) configured to measure a physical property such as pressure or movement. A sensing circuit (185) senses a bridge current (Ipbridge, Inbridge) that flows through the resistive bridge circuit (102) in response to the applied bias voltage. A temperature dependent sensitivity of the resistive bridge circuit (102) is determined by processing the sensed bridge current. A voltage output at first (146) and second (148) output nodes of the resistive bridge circuit (102) is processed to determine a value of the physical property. This processing further involves applying a temperature correction in response to the determined temperature dependent sensitivity.

Abstract: In a single-stage differential operational amplifier (30): an input stage formed by a pair of input transistors (31, 32), having control terminals connected to a respective first and second input (IN+, IN - ), first conduction terminals coupled to a respective first and second output (OUT-, OUT + ) and second conduction terminals able to receive a polarization current (I b ); an output stage formed by a pair of output transistors (34, 35), in diode configuration, having control terminals able to be coupled to a relative first conduction terminal, connected to a respective first and second output (OUT-, OUT+), and second conduction terminals connected to a reference line (gnd). A coupling stage (36) is furthermore interposed between the first conduction terminals of the output transistors (34, 35) and the first and second output (OUT-, OUT+) to define the diode configuration of the output transistors (34, 35) and moreover a gain value (G) of the operational amplifier (30) .
